Bank card storage box
Technical Field
The utility model relates to a technical field is stored to the bank card, specifically is a box is stored to bank card.
Background
The blank bank card belongs to an important blank certificate of a bank, and has strict requirements on use and management. When a bank conducts mobile bank cards, business personnel are required to carry a plurality of blank bank cards, and the risk of improper storage and loss exists.
To this end, the chinese application patent No.: CN201720743629.4 discloses a bank card heavy-empty management box, which is characterized in that blank bank cards are sequentially loaded into a card storage box, information is input in an interaction module to control a mechanical card pushing assembly to push out a bank card arranged at the bottom of the card storage box, and the bank card can read and write information of the bank card after pushing out the card storage box and pushing in a contact type IC card reading and writing module and display the information on the interaction module; when the bank conducts the bank card opening business in a mobile manner, the device well considers the requirements of light weight of equipment used for service, flexibility of combined use of software and hardware and the compliance of bank card weight management, and simultaneously adopts mature technology to reduce use cost and technical complexity.
When the card pushing sliding block is used for pushing the bank card, the bank card on the upper side can be pushed, so that the bank card on the upper side is inclined, and the bank card can be pushed out in the card storage box smoothly.
Therefore, in order to solve the above problems, a bank card storage box is proposed.

Drawings
FIG. 1 is a schematic front view of the structure of the box body of the present invention;
fig. 2 is a schematic sectional view of the placement groove in front view;
fig. 3 is a schematic structural side view of the push-out structure of the present invention;
fig. 4 is a schematic top view of the supporting structure of the present invention;
fig. 5 is a schematic diagram of the structure explosion of the push-out structure and the supporting structure of the present invention.
In the figure: 1. a box body; 11. a placement groove; 12. a movable groove; 13. a bayonet outlet; 14. a card body; 2. a push-out structure; 21. a push rod; 22. a connecting rod; 23. a first spring; 24. a motor; 25. a threaded rod; 26. a push block; 3. a support structure; 31. a fixing rod; 32. a top block; 33. a limiting block; 34. a movable block; 35. a second spring.

Referring to fig. 1-5, the present invention provides an embodiment:
the motor 24 used in the present application is a commercially available product, and the principle and connection method thereof are well known in the art, and therefore will not be described herein.
A bank card storage case comprising: the box body 1, standing groove 11 has been seted up to the top surface of box body 1, movable groove 12 has been seted up to the rear end of standing groove 11 bottom surface, bayonet socket 13 has been seted up out in the front of box body 1, card main part 14 has been placed to the inside of standing groove 11, the internally mounted of box body 1 has ejecting structure 2, ejecting structure 2 includes push rod 21, push rod 21 is provided with two sets ofly, two sets of push rod 21 are all slidable mounting in the inside of box body 1, two sets of push rod 21 pass through connecting rod 22 fixed connection, the first spring 23 of fixedly connected with on the rear wall of connecting rod 22, the inside fixed mounting of box body 1 has motor 24, the output fixedly connected with threaded rod 25 of motor 24, the front end cover of push rod 21 is equipped with ejector pad 26, ejector pad 26 can cooperate the card main part 14 of releasing, erect the card main part 14 of upside, make the card main part 14 of upside keep neatly arranged, can guarantee smooth release of card main part 14, and improve the result of use.
Further, the internally mounted of box body 1 has bearing structure 3, bearing structure 3 includes dead lever 31, dead lever 31 fixed welding is on push block 26's the wall of controlling, the inside movable mounting in bottom surface of standing groove 11 has kicking block 32, the welding has stopper 33 on the wall about kicking block 32, the inside movable mounting in bottom surface of kicking block 32 has movable block 34, the top surface fixedly connected with second spring 35 of movable block 34, the kicking block 32 can be after card main part 14 releases, cooperation push block 26 continues to support the card main part 14 of upside, and after push rod 21 resets, can place the card main part 14 of upside at the bottom surface of standing groove 11.
Further, the placement groove 11 communicates with the inside of the card outlet 13, the thickness of the card body 14 is the same as the height of the card outlet 13, and the card body 14 can be moved out of the inside of the case 1 from the inside of the placement groove 11 through the card outlet 13.
Further, the height of the push rod 21 is smaller than the thickness of the card main body 14, the connecting rod 22 is located on the front side of the push block 26, the rear end of the first spring 23 is fixedly connected with the push block 26, the push rod 21 cannot scratch the card main body 14 on the upper side, and the first spring 23 provides connection for the movement of the push rod 21 to drive the push block 26 to move in the movable groove 12.
Furthermore, the threaded rod 25 is located inside the push rod 21, the push rod 21 is in threaded connection with the threaded rod 25, the bottom end of the push block 26 is located inside the movable groove 12, the push rod 21 rotates to drive the threaded rod 25 to move inside the box body 1, and the movable groove 12 can limit the moving distance of the push block 26.
Further, the front end of the fixed rod 31 is located under the movable block 34, the top end of the second spring 35 is fixedly connected with the inner wall of the top block 32, the top surface of the top block 32 is flush with the bottom surface of the placement groove 11, the movable rod 31 can move to push the movable block 34 to move in the vertical direction, and the second spring 35 provides power for the top block 32 to extend out of the bottom surface of the placement groove 11.
The working principle is as follows: when the card pushing device is used, the motor 24 is started, the motor 24 drives the threaded rod 25 to rotate, the threaded rod 25 drives the pushing rod 21 to move in the box body 1, the pushing rod 21 drives the pushing block 26 to slide in the movable groove 12, the pushing block 26 moves to the inside of the placing groove 11 to push the bottommost card body 14, the pushing block 26 is matched with the pushed card body 14 to support the card body 14 on the upper side, the card bodies 14 on the upper side are kept in regular arrangement, smooth pushing of the card bodies 14 can be guaranteed, the using effect is improved, the pushing block 26 is limited by the movable groove 12 and cannot move all the time, the pushing rod 21 can extend out of the pushing block 26 to continuously push the card bodies 14, the card bodies 14 are exposed out of the front face of the box body 1 through the card outlet 13, the height of the pushing rod 21 is smaller than the thickness of the card bodies 14, when the pushing rod 21 pushes the card bodies 14, the pushing rod 21 cannot be in contact with the card bodies 14 on the upper side, abrasion to the card bodies 14 on the upper side can be reduced, and the using effect is better.
When the pushing block 26 moves in the movable slot 12, the fixed rod 31 is driven to move, the fixed rod 31 pushes the movable block 34 to move upwards, the movable block 34 drives the ejecting block 32 to move upwards through the second spring 35, the top surface of the ejecting block 32 is blocked by the bottommost card body 14 and cannot move, the upper end of the movable block 34 moves upwards in the ejecting block 32 and extrudes the second spring 35, after the card body 14 passes through the top surface of the ejecting block 32, the blocking of the top surface of the ejecting block 32 is eliminated, namely, the movable block rises from the bottom surface of the placing slot 11 under the action of the second spring 35, the top surface of the ejecting block 32 is in contact with the card body 14 on the upper side, the front end of the card body 14 on the upper side can be supported, the card body 14 on the upper side can be continuously erected by matching with the pushing block 26, the card body 14 on the upper side is kept in order, and when the pushing rod 21 is reset, the pushing block 26 and the ejecting block 32 are both restored, the card body 14 on the upper side can be in contact with the bottom surface of the placing slot 11, and preparation is made for next pushing out of the card body 14.
